120-Watt Portable Solar Pannel



It’s hard to beat the balance of quality, output and price with the Go Power! lineup. A division of Carmanah Technologies, Go Power! knows their 12v systems and features power offerings up to 480 watts for RV’s.

In their portable systems they’ve simply shrunk down the panels, added a sturdy suitcase design and made their easy to operate systems available in smaller wattages.

Offering monocrystalline panels shows the focus on quality.
An 10 amp LCD display PWM (pulse width modification) charge controller with hinge for easy readability, sturdy folding legs round and proven Anderson style connectors make this panel a safe investment.

While priced higher than similar power output panels (like SUAOKI 25W ) you’ll find the small things like wire size (10 awg), cord length (12’) and sturdy construction more than justify the added cost. We’ve been using our 120 watt panel for over a month as of this writing and we couldn’t be more pleased with the array.

So simple to operate, easy to setup/stow away and we get every bit of power promised and then some from the array! We average about 7.4 amps (12v) during full sun which is higher than the rated output. Can’t beat that!

The ballistics style carrying case is reassuring when stowing the array so as not to scratch or damage the glass which is exposed when the setup is folded for storage. A swing hinge on the charge controller is so helpful and makes reading the LCD display much easier without having to stoop and bend. The data output on the LCD is also helpful as you can roughly calculate the power you’ll capture that day and either ramp up power use during the day or conserve.

Overall we highly recommend this panel and feel for most people in the mid-range of power needs, budget and size this panel does it all.
